Newmar After Warranty Long Term Support
Does Newmar provide support after the warranty is up. For example if I need something repaired or desire a modification that's not too crazy, can I make an appointment and pay to have it done at the factory?
If yes, is there a time limit, for example can I expect to use the factory 10 years down the road?

Newmar runs a winter, off season, special on labor rates. But you need to make reservations now for this coming winter. And yes they will work on older rigs as well as new ones.
They only do it for a few months each year, then they won't even take a reservation for any paid work.

I have an 05 coach. Newmar continues to provide the service needed for the coach. They are so busy getting an appointment can be a PITA. Winter does provide a bit more flexibility however they will provide an appointment anytime during the year.

Yes, Newmar provides great support to me and my 2004 coach. I have the sidewalls replaced, repainted and a number of other things done at Newmar this last winter. You need to make an appointment and you need to plan well ahead.
